Ingredients
For the Peanut Butter Filling
- 1 cup creamy peanut butter ā where the only ingredients are peanuts and salt
- 1 + 1/3 cups + 2 tablespoons blanched almond flour
- 1/4 cup real maple syrup
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- Pinch of kosher salt
For the Chocolate Coating
- 12 ounces dark chocolate chips or dark chocolate bar
- 1 teaspoon coconut oil
How to Make Healthy Reeseās Peanut Butter Eggs ā Gluten Free
Step 1: Prepare Your Baking Sheet
- Line a medium-sized baking sheet with parchment paper or a baking mat. Set aside.
Step 2: Make the Peanut Butter Filling
- In a mixing bowl, combine the peanut butter, almond flour, maple syrup, vanilla extract, and kosher salt. Mix until you achieve a thick, smooth consistency.
Step 3: Shape the Eggs
- Take about 1.5 tablespoons of the peanut butter mixture.
- Roll it into a ball, then flatten it slightly to form an egg shape about 1/2 to 3/4 inch thick.
- Place each shaped egg on the lined baking sheet, ensuring they are spaced apart.
- Freeze the eggs for 30 minutes; this step is crucial!
Step 4: Melt the Chocolate Coating
- In a microwave-safe bowl, combine the dark chocolate chips and coconut oil.
- Microwave in 30-second intervals, stirring in between until fully melted.
- Let it cool at room temperature for about 5 minutes.
Step 5: Coat the Eggs in Chocolate
- Remove the frozen peanut butter eggs from the freezer.
- Using a fork, dip each egg into the melted chocolate until fully coated.
- Allow excess chocolate to drip off by tapping the fork gently on the side of your bowl before placing it back on the baking sheet.
Step 6: Add Finishing Touches
- Drizzle any leftover chocolate over each egg for decoration.
- Optionally sprinkle sea salt on top for added flavor.
Step 7: Final Chill Before Enjoying
- Return your dipped eggs to the freezer for another 10-15 minutes to set completely.
- Enjoy your homemade Healthy Reeseās Peanut Butter Eggs ā Gluten Free!

Common Mistakes to Avoid
Making Healthy Reeseās Peanut Butter Eggs can be a fun experience, but there are common pitfalls to avoid for the best results.
- Skipping the Freezing Step ā The freezing step is crucial for setting the peanut butter eggs. If you skip it, the eggs may not hold their shape when dipped in chocolate.
- Using Low-Quality Chocolate ā Using inferior chocolate can lead to a less tasty coating. Opt for high-quality dark chocolate chips or bars for a richer flavor.
- Not Measuring Ingredients Accurately ā Accurate measurements ensure consistency in texture and taste. Use measuring cups and spoons for precise amounts.
- Overheating the Chocolate ā Overheating can cause chocolate to seize. Melt it in short intervals and stir frequently to achieve a smooth consistency.
- Neglecting to Space Out Eggs on the Baking Sheet ā Crowding the eggs can lead to them sticking together. Make sure they are well-spaced on the baking sheet before freezing.

Frequently Asked Questions
What makes these Healthy Reeseās Peanut Butter Eggs gluten-free?
These eggs use almond flour instead of traditional wheat flour, making them suitable for those avoiding gluten.
Can I customize my Healthy Reeseās Peanut Butter Eggs?
Absolutely! You can add chopped nuts, coconut flakes, or different flavors of extract to suit your taste.
How do I store leftover Healthy Reeseās Peanut Butter Eggs?
Store them in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to one week or freeze them for longer storage.
What type of chocolate should I use?
For best results, use high-quality dark chocolate chips or bars that have minimal ingredients and a rich flavor.
How long does it take to make these Healthy Reeseās Peanut Butter Eggs?
The total time is about one hour, including preparation and chilling time before dipping in chocolate.
